| name = Clappia | image = Clappia umbilicata shell 2.png | image_caption = Drawing of apertural view of the shell and its operculum of Clappia umbilicata | regnum = Animalia | phylum = Mollusca | classis = Gastropoda | unranked_superfamilia = clade Caenogastropoda clade Hypsogastropoda clade Littorinimorpha | superfamilia = Rissooidea | familia = Lithoglyphidae | genus = Clappia | genus_authority = Walker, 1909[1] | diversity_ref = [2] | diversity_link = #Species | diversity = 2 species }}Clappia is a genus of small freshwater snails that have an operculum, aquatic gastropod mollusks in the family Lithoglyphidae.[2] Generic name Clappia is in honor of malacologist George Hubbard Clapp.[1] SpeciesThere are two[2] species within the genus Clappia:
